The sunflower usually grows to about 6 ft. tall and bears wide bright yellow disc florets with yellow or brown red centers. While growing, the beautiful ray will follow the suns path, but once the flower matures it generally will face east. Sunflowers are known not only for their big cheerful flower heads but also for the seeds that are enjoyed for a nutritious snack for humans as well as food for the birds and squirrels. The bright yellow flower will attract bees which are a great benefit for pollination in agriculture. Sunflowers were grown 1000's of years ago by the Native Americans as an important food source.
